Find the top Soft drinks shops in San Antonio, Texas near you now.
Sandwich shop
Address: 22831 US-281 Suite 106, San Antonio, TX 78258
Convenience store
Address: 11311 US-281, San Antonio, TX 78221
Address: 5345 Roosevelt Ave, San Antonio, TX 78214